Incorporating it into daily rituals can help break cycles of negativity and restore a vibrant sense of motivation. Insect Repellent and Household Freshening Nature’s defense against pests, patchouli oil is a highly effective insect repellent.
Its strong odor is disruptive to mosquitoes, fleas, and other bothersome insects, providing a safe alternative to chemical-laden sprays.
